Alterations in Cholesterol, Glucose and Triglyceride Levels in Reproduction of Rainbow Trout (Oncorhynchus mykiss)

Abstract: The changes in glucose, cholesterol and Triglyceride (TG) levels were investigated during reproductive process stages of rainbow trout (Onchorhynchus mykiss). TG level decreased significantly from maturation to spawning in both sexes. Cholesterol levels fluctuated significantly during reproduction period. Glucose levels increased at maturation then decreased throughout the spawning. Low density level value increased to ovulation then fluctuated to post-spawning. High density lipoprotein values sharply decreased then increased and fluctuated significantly during the reproduction. Very low density lipoprotein values immediately increased then decreased and fluctuated significantly from pre-maturation to post spawning.
